**Vendor note: Inkmill markdown pipeline**

Rendering for Parchway docs is outsourced to Inkmill under an annual contract, renewing each March. They handle sanitization and PDF export; we own the upload queue. SLA: 4-hour response on rendering failures. Escalate only after two failed retries. Their support desk is reachable at the address below.

billing contact of hahaf-baguf = zorael.tammir.jorius@sivrelhq.internal

Release channel — Fernpage template rendering is now ~3x faster after we moved compilation out of the request path and into a warm cache. Cache invalidation keys off template checksum, so stale renders are impossible by construction. Future maintainers: do not add per-request compile flags; they defeat the cache. Perf baselines updated. The benchmarked build carries the trace token below.

session token of bawep-yadup = htk21_528abd376e3c5a4ec24a1

Velvetline Environments — Canary Gating

Velvetline runs three environments: sandbox, staging, and production. Plugin releases promoted to production pass through an automatic canary stage. Gating compares error rate, latency, and crash count against the stable fleet; a failing gate rolls the plugin back without notice. Plugin authors cannot override gates per release. The gating thresholds currently enforced in production are as follows.

settings of taguf-fajef:
[eliath]
team = julir
access_code = ac_78465c
host = eliath.lumicgrid.local
port = 8443
owner = feniel.wenir
peer = quenmir.tolvaqsys.local

### Descriptor Audit Endpoint

While chasing the leaked file descriptors in Burrowtrace, we added `/v2/fd-audit`, which snapshots every open handle the Quillhaven gateway holds and tags the owning request. Handy when the pool quietly bleeds sockets overnight. It's gated behind the internal ops tier, so plain session tokens won't cut it — you need a service key with the `fd:inspect` scope. Hit it sparingly; each snapshot pauses the accept loop for a few milliseconds. Authenticate with the key below.

service key, yadug-bajog: zpat3_pou